LFP Batteries Are Now the Premium Choice: Lithium Iron Phosphate (LFP) batteries have emerged as the top recommendation for 2025, offering superior safety with no thermal runaway risk, longer lifespan (6,000-10,000 cycles), and better performance in extreme temperatures, despite costing 10-20% more. .

New research from the University of Bern in Switzerland has demonstrated that the installation of a residential rooftop PV system could increase a household's power consumption by up to 11%. This rise is linked to electric vehicle adoption or other high-usage appliances, which the study's author notes is not inherently negative or wasteful. Image: University of Bern. . A three phase inverter is a device that converts direct current (DC), often from solar panels or another DC source, into alternating current (AC) across three distinct output phases.
